Exegesis means drawing out the true meaning of a Bible passage, and it should be the goal of all Bible study. ... Eisegesis means reading one's own ideas into interpretation of the Bible. We all have our own beliefs, world view and biases, and letting them influence our interpretation of the Bible is an ever-present danger!
